Mastering the Angle Grinder Tool for Precision Work

An angle grinder tool acts as a versatile resource for cutting, sanding, and refining surfaces ranging from porcelain to metal rods. To accomplish professional outcomes, users must choose the appropriate disc for each job—abrasive wheels for masonry or flap discs for metal. Proper technique entails maintaining a steady handle and using even pressure to prevent patchy surfaces. For complex work, reducing the RPM and using dedicated add-ons boosts precision. Periodic upkeep, including lubrication, increases the equipment’s lifespan.

Optimizing Performance with Variable Speed Angle Grinders

The variable speed angle grinder differs by offering modifiable RPM settings, allowing users to adapt functionality to specific substances and tasks. This capability avoids damage to fragile materials like sheet metal while maximizing productivity on rigid substrates. For instance, reducing the RPM when polishing acrylic avoids deformation, whereas increased speeds expedite shaping tasks. High-end models include smart regulation technologies that dynamically modulate output based on load, ensuring consistent results.

Enhancing Safety Protocols for Angle Grinder Use

Although their utility, angle grinders present considerable hazards if handled incorrectly. Vital steps include wearing safety accessories such as eye protection, gauntlets, and flame-retardant clothing. Consistently inspect the grinder for defects before application, ensuring the protection is firmly fastened and the blade is undamaged. Prevent pushing the tool through workpieces, as this increases the risk of sudden movement. When replacing discs, unplug the more info power source to avoid accidental startup. Adhering to these practices lowers job site incidents.
